473.astar 7020 467 15.0 * 7020 459 15.3 * 483.xalancbmk 6900 240 28.7 * 6900 240 28.7 * SPECint(R)_base2006 26.2 SPECint2006 28.6 HARDWARE -------- CPU Name: Intel Core i3-540 CPU Characteristics: CPU MHz: 3067 FPU: Integrated CPU(s) enabled: 2 cores, 1 chip, 2 cores/chip CPU(s) orderable: 1 chip Primary Cache: 32 KB I + 32 KB D on chip per core Secondary Cache: 256 KB I+D on chip per core L3 Cache: 4 MB I+D on chip per chip Other Cache: None Memory: 8 GB (2x4 GB PC3-10600E, 2 rank, CL9-9-9, ECC) Disk Subsystem: 1 x SATA, 250 GB, 7200 RPM Other Hardware: None SOFTWARE -------- Operating System: SUSE Linux Enterprise Server 11 (x86_64), Kernel 2.6.27.19-5-smp Compiler: Intel C++ Professional Compiler for IA32 and Intel 64, Version 11.1 Build 20091012 Package ID: l_cproc_p_11.1.059 Auto Parallel: Yes File System: ext3 System State: Multi-User Run Level 3 Base Pointers: 32-bit Peak Pointers: 32/64-bit Other Software: Microquill SmartHeap V8.1 Binutils 2.18.50.0.7.20080502 Operating System Notes ---------------------- 'ulimit -s unlimited' was used to set the stacksize to unlimited prior to run General Notes ------------- OMP_NUM_THREADS set to number of cores KMP_AFFINITY set to granularity=fine,scatter For information about Fujitsu please visit: http://www.fujitsu.com Base Compiler Invocation ------------------------ C benchmarks: icc -m64 C++ benchmarks:
